Microscopic origins of the spin-Hamiltonian parameters for 3d2 state ions in a crystal
|
Abstract:
By adopting the intermediate field scheme, the microscopic origins of the spin Hamiltanian (SH) parameters for 3d 2 ion at trigonal ( C 3v , D 3, D 3d ) symmetry, taking into account the spin spin(SS) and spin other orbit(SOO) coupling interactions omitted in previous publications, have been investigated on the basis of complete diagonalization method(CDM). We find that the SH parameters arise from four microscopic mechanisms, i.e. (1) Spin orbit(SO) coupling mechanism; (2) SS coupling mechanism; (3) SOO coupling mechanism; (4) SO SS SOO combined coupling mechanism. The SO coupling mechanism in the four coupling mechanisms is the most important one, but the contributions to zero field splitting parameter D from other three coupling mechanisms cannot be omitted.
